Regards, Adrià El 14/03/2007, a las 18:50, Michael Edwards escribió: > I have seen this issue on my Dell PE2950 and PE1955 systems, but from > reading the paper this may be a fairly common problem. I found a > whitepaper from Dell describing why in some cases NIC cards are not > labeled by linux in the way one might expect. > > http://linux.dell.com/files/whitepapers/nic-enum-whitepaper-v2.pdf > > In my case there are two cards, one labeled Gig1 and Gig2 which ended > up switched from my perspective and named eth1 and eth0 respectively. > Anyway, dell wrote a set of scripts which fixes this as well as > describing what the scripts do if you want to do it by hand. They > describe fixes for SLES 9 and 10 as well as RHEL 3+ > > The scripts work for my headnode, which has both NICs active, but did > not work on my compute node because the oscar image only has one > activated by default (which is still numbered wrong). I plan to > deactivate the second NIC on my compute nodes in the BIOS since I do > not need it, which also fixes the problem. > > Just thought I would share... > > ---------------------------------------------------------------------- > --- > Take Surveys.
